## Deployment

The Charsleuth encoding-detection service runs as a sidecar to the upload gateway. On deploy, it loads the detection model, warms the confidence tables, and registers with the Penmark ingest bus. Files under 4 KB use the byte-histogram fallback rather than the full detector, since short samples produce unreliable guesses. Roll out one region at a time and watch misdetection alerts for ten minutes. The deployed service reads the following values at startup.

deployment values, tafof-taduf:
pelius:
  pin: 6508
  tenant: praiel
  seal: seal_4e33a2f4
  metrics_host: metrics.pelius.plorvagrid.corp
  standby_team: druix
  escalation: juldor-norius
  nonce: 5db598

## Deployment: Export Retry Worker

The Lanternfell export retry worker redrives failed report exports from the dead-letter queue. Deploy it only after the main exporter is healthy, otherwise retries will fail again and inflate the attempt counters. On-call engineers should verify that the backoff ceiling and max-attempt settings match what is committed in the release branch before scaling the worker above one replica. The configuration values the worker reads at startup are shown below.

config for haweg-bagag:
[kasath]
host = kasath.qirvancorp.internal
user = kasath_svc
database = kasath_prod

Ticket #— Floor 9 Opening Prep, Brindlemoor House

Hi facilities folks, Floor 9 opens to staff next Monday and we need a few things squared away before then. Lift access is live, but the two side doors by the kitchenette are still on the old lock config — please reprogram them before Friday. Also, signage for the quiet rooms hasn't arrived, so pop up the temporary printed ones for now. Until the badge readers sync, the interim door code for Floor 9 is below.

door code, bajop-bajog: bdg-DSWAC-43621

## Changelog — RenderMill transcoding farm, v5.1

Future maintainers, a small but annoying rename: `FARM_TOKEN` is now `RENDERMILL_WORKER_AUTH_SECRET`. The old name dated back to when the farm had one worker pool and zero auth layers; now that ingest, transcode, and packaging workers all share the bus, the vague name caused real confusion (and one outage, ask around). The old variable is ignored as of this release — no fallback, on purpose. Update each worker's env file by adding the new secret on the line right after this sentence.

vault entry, kafog-yahop: COURIER_KEY8=0faa53ae